JOHN JABEZ EDWIN MAYALL (1813-1901)
Prince Albert (1819-61)
c. 1855Wet collodion negative | RCIN 2084852
Glass plate negative of a near full length portrait of Prince Albert. He is shown seated. The photograph may have been taken outdoors.
A hand coloured version of this work exists in the Royal Collection, RCIN 2151448.
